Aerating is a critical yard care practice that includes boring the soil to improve air, water, and nutrient penetration. This process minimizes soil compaction, motivates root development, and enhances total turf health. Aeration is particularly beneficial for high-traffic areas and heavy clay soils that limit water movement and root development. Methods include using plug or spike aerators, which develop holes in the lawn for better flow. Aeration is frequently followed by fertilization, overseeding, or topdressing to maximize outcomes. Timing is important, with spring and fall being perfect for a lot of turf types. Routine aeration promotes resilient, thick, and green lawns, lowers water overflow, and boosts nutrient uptake. Integrating aeration into seasonal yard care regimens guarantees optimum long-lasting health and aesthetic appeals
